How to Test Skin Care Water Content



Simple and effective way as a chemist or home user to test in the laboratory or at home the water content of a skin care or skin cream
  1. Weight 5 to 10 grams of the sample in a tared hot plate or tared or pre-weighed beaker.
  2. Record the weight of the empty plate or beaker as WB
  3. Record the wight of the sample of the skincare as WS
  4. Put the plate and the sample in an oven for a period of 1 hour at a temperature of 100-105 degrees Celcius


Caclculate the value of the water content with the following formula

WA - WB
Water Content = ----------------- x 100 - 100
WS



Example = Weight After = 56.40 grams
Weight Before = 52 grams
Weight of the sample = 5 grams


So


Water Content is 56.40 - 52.0
----------------- x 100 - 100
5.0

= 12% Water Content

Water Content that is at least below 85% is passed or of good or tolerable quality. Skin Care and Skin creams water content are done this simple way in laboratories, of cosmetics and skin care labs.
